Inorganic lead is a malleable, blue-gray, heavy metal that occurs naturally in the Earth's crust. Lead was one of the first metals used by humans and consequently, the cause of the first recorded occupational disease (lead colic in a 4th century BC metal worker).

Lead-based paint abatement The Lead-Based Paint Hazard Reduction Act of 1992 states "abatement" refers to the methods used to permanently get rid of lead-based paint hazards. HUD has defined permanent as lasting at least 20 years. Getting rid of lead-based paint hazards means making lead-based paint unavailable, so that it is no longer a ...

Dec 04, 2012· 3. Grinding meets the "no lead" specification. This spec refers to the "spiral" visible on a turned shaft. It is created by a single-point cutting tool moving transversely as the part rotates on a lathe. This surface pattern can cause premature failure of seals on a shaft. By plunge grinding the shaft, the lead is eliminated.

Lead Hazard Engineering Controls. Because lead is a cumulative and persistent toxic substance and because lead-caused health effects may result from low levels of exposure over prolonged periods of time, engineering controls and good work practices must be used where feasible to minimize employee exposure to lead.

Ironworkers, painters, laborers, and other construction workers may be exposed to lead during repair of bridges and steel structures. Workers need protection whenever they disturb or remove lead paint - when torch cutting, grinding, scaling, needle gunning, rivet busting, and cleaning-up.

Effect of Ball Size and Properties on Mill Grinding Capacity Current ball milling theory suggests that grinding capacity is influenced by the size of balls charged to the mill. In selecting the appropriate ball charge, the first objective is to determine that ball size which will grind the coarse particles most efficiently. This size should be the largest ball size charged to the mill.
